Before diving into the album, it's crucial to understand the man behind the music. Peter Tosh, born Winston Hubert McIntosh, was not just a musician; he was a fierce activist, a Rastafarian prophet, and a co-founder of The Wailers alongside Bob Marley and Bunny Wailer. While Marley often aimed for universal appeal, Tosh was the group's uncompromising, militant edge, a role he carried into his solo career with albums like Legalize It (1976) and Equal Rights (1977). His music was a weapon against injustice, a platform for spiritual strength, and a declaration of personal conviction. By 1981, Tosh was ready to reinforce his status as reggae's "militant poet" with Wanted Dread & Alive , an album that balanced his roots with a more polished production aimed at an international audience. The title track is the thematic anchor of the record. With a haunting, slow-burning roots rhythm, Tosh addresses the constant surveillance, targeting, and harassment he faced from authorities.
